The Milwaukee Brewers enter the neutral-site Little League Classic matchup holding the NL’s best record at 81-49 and riding a 7-3 stretch with superior recent pitching and a league-leading .337 team OBP. Atlanta (75-55) has cooled off sharply at 3-7 over its last 10 games, posting a .220 team batting average while dealing with long-term absences for starters like Spencer Strider and Spencer Schwellenbach. The probable pitching duel favors Milwaukee, with left-hander Shane Drohan (6-4, 3.86 ERA) facing right-hander Tyler Mahle (4-10, 4.53 ERA). The Brewers also lead the season series 3-2 after taking the first two games of this set by scores of 2-1 and 4-1, giving traders a clear consensus edge to the Central leaders based on form, depth, and head-to-head results.
